Indian Government will ensure availability of Essential Drugs at Reasonable Prices

The Government will ensure availability of essential drugs including those for cancer and AIDs at reasonable prices. Announcing this at a Press conference here today, Minister of Chemicals & Fertilizers and Steel , Shri Ram Vilas Paswan said that a Task Force constituted by the Government was examining the various aspects concerning drug prices.

He said that 74 bulk drugs specified in the first schedule of drugs (Prices Control) Order, 1995 and the formulations based thereon are under price control.

Prices of non-scheduled formulations are fixed by the manufacturers themselves. However, The Government takes corrective measures where the public interest is found to be adversely affected.

Earlier, a Committee under the Chairmanship of Joint Secretary, (PI) was constituted to examine the span of price control (including trade margin) and to suggest measures for fulfilling the objective of National Common Minimum Programme to ensure the availability of life saving drugs at reasonable prices.
